The global fuel cell catalyst market is on a significant growth trajectory, with a forecasted value of USD 1,338.6 million by 2035, expanding at a noteworthy CAGR of 8.1%. This surge is attributed to the rising adoption of fuel cells across various sectors such as transportation, stationary power generation, and portable applications. The market is primarily driven by global initiatives to reduce carbon emissions and promote sustainable energy solutions. Fuel cell catalysts, particularly platinum-based ones, play a crucial role in enabling efficient electrochemical reactions to convert fuels like hydrogen into electricity with minimal environmental impact. The article delves into market dynamics, key trends, challenges, and opportunities shaping the fuel cell catalyst industry. Key drivers include the global push for decarbonization, technological advancements enhancing catalyst efficiency, and supportive government policies and investments encouraging market growth. Despite its optimistic outlook, challenges such as the high cost of platinum-based catalysts, limited hydrogen infrastructure, and water management issues in PEMFCs need to be addressed for the market to reach its full potential. Regionally, East Asia, North America, and Western Europe stand out as significant markets for fuel cell catalyst adoption, with countries like China, U.S., Germany, and the UK spearheading developments and investments in the sector.
